Multiplication of distributions and singular waves in several physical models

Abstract

AbstractWe study of a Riemann problem for a one-dimensional $$2\hspace{1.111pt}{\times }\hspace{1.111pt}2$$ 2 × 2 system of conservation laws, which includes some particular cases of known physical systems, such as the pressureless gas dynamics system, Euler equations for isentropic flow, the Brio system, and the shallow water system. The main results of this study reveal the emergence of shock waves and delta shock waves as explicit solutions. We use the concept of $$\alpha $$ α -solution defined in the setting of a product of distributions not defined by approximation. Notably, this study does not assume any classical results about conservation laws, presenting a simpler and more general framework for constructing singular solutions to other equations or systems. Additionally, this paper includes several comments on the four physical systems mentioned, along with formulas for multiplying distributions and evaluating the compositions of a function with a distribution.
